TURN-208: Gatevale turnstile counters at the Merrow Field pilot double-count when a rotation reverses mid-cycle. Attendance totals drift roughly 2% high per event. The debounce window fix is implemented, reviewed by Ilsa, and soak-tested across two simulated match days without drift. Ready for your cut; the candidate build is identified below.

trace token, tagag-tafog: htk6_5ed18c

Hey, quick one before you approve the Quartzline PR: the static-analysis baseline file (`lintbase.snapshot`) hasn't refreshed since the Brindlecove cutover because the uploader's credentials expired last Tuesday. Every new branch is diffing against a stale baseline, so you'll see a pile of phantom warnings in review. Ignore those for now. I rotated the service credential this morning and verified a manual push works. To regenerate the baseline locally, run `lintbase refresh` with the new key below.

gateway credential: kto3_qfe

Handover note — Crumbwheel order cutoffs.

Welcome aboard. The bakery cutoff rule in Crumbwheel closes same-day orders at 14:00 local to each storefront, not UTC — this has bitten us twice. Holiday overrides live in the calendar service and take precedence silently, so always check there first when a cutoff looks wrong. To unlock the calendar service's admin console after a restart, enter the recovery passphrase below.

vault phrase of bagap-bahaf = silion-pelox-sorox-casdor-quenwyn-fraax-eliox-praael-kelion-quenvan-kasox-rusael-norius-belvan

## Handover: ORM Refactor (Quillbase → Lathe)

Status for eng sync: legacy Quillbase ORM layer is 60% migrated to Lathe repositories. Remaining: billing models and the audit-log adapter. Do not touch the session-caching shim until billing lands — it papers over a lazy-load bug. Tests green on the migration branch. Rollback plan: feature flag per model group. The staging instance I've been validating against runs with the following configuration values.

service settings:
[casax]
port = 6379
team = rusir
host = casax.zemvarhq.corp
region = outer-4
access_code = ac_9808ce
timeout_ms = 1500